Gold mining ETFs - Nomura reiterates bullish stance on gold equities

Investment banking giant Nomura has released a report on gold equities which is highly bullish for gold mining ETFs. According to the report, record cash generation, a new industry focus on financial returns, as well as a potential forward softening in mining capex and operating cost inflation suggest that the historically low valuations currently priced into the gold mining sector are unlikely to persist.

Market Vectors eyes international expansion

Market Vectors ETFs, the fifth largest provider of exchange-traded products in the US and the eighth largest provider globally, has signalled its global ambitions by partnering with Australian Index Investments (Aii) to launch Market Vectors Australia. Meanwhile, in a further demonstration of the firm’s international expansion plans, five NYSE Arca-traded Market Vectors ETFs have been added to the growing list of Market Vectors ETFs currently available to Qualified Investors in Mexico.

Dow Jones Indexes, a leading global index provider, and FXCM, a global online provider of foreign exchange trading, have announced the launch of the Dow Jones FXCM Yen Index. The new index measures changes in the value of the Japanese yen against a basket of four of the most-transacted currencies against the yen: the US dollar, the euro, the Australian dollar and the New Zealand dollar.

DeltaOne Solutions, a provider of financial data solutions, has released a new database containing 10-years of historical data covering constituent history and pricing for tens of thousands of indices and ETFs. The database includes official index value, constituent data, global coverage, fully cross-referenced security identifiers and is retrievable in a variety of formats via a web interface for download or an API.

First Trust Advisors, a US-based ETF provider, has announced the launch of the First Trust North American Energy Infrastructure Fund (EMLP), an actively managed ETF designed to provide exposure to companies engaged in the North American energy infrastructure sector. First Trust believes this is an opportune time to invest in energy infrastructure assets, in part because of the new technologies that have been developed to extract previously inaccessible natural gas and oil supplies trapped in shale deposits in North America.

Morningstar has published details of a study which delves into the data points that measure the true cost of ETF ownership. The key finding: keep an eye on Total Cost of Ownership (TCO). Morningstar found that, while clearly ETFs cost less on average, poor trade execution or poor ETF selection can actually negate the expense ratio advantage.

Japan’s exports jumped 10% in May, according to data from Japan’s Ministry of finance. Imports also increased during the month in a sign that domestic demand may also be picking up. Overall, the data eases concerns about the impact of a global slowdown on the Japanese economy, raising interest in Japanese equity ETFs. Katsuaki Ogata, a CIO at Alliance Bernstein, believes that, at today’s valuations, Japanese equities offer an “exceptional investment opportunity” and that the Japanese market is “available at historically attractive prices”.

Lynas, Molycorp lead rebound in Rare Earth ETFs, as China warns of depleting supply

Over the past week shares in two of the largest rare earth metals producers, Lynas (LYC) and Molycorp (MCP), have rallied on a combination of stock-specific and industry news. The strong performance from these two sector heavy weights has pushed up rare earth ETFs, including the Market Vectors Rare Earth/Strategic Metals ETF (REMX) and the UBS-ETF STOXX Global Rare Earth (UIMV), which are showing signs of rebounding from recent lows.

SSgA adds two new SPDR ETFs tracking crossover and EM corporate bonds

State Street Global Advisors has announced the launch of two new corporate bond ETFs, the SPDR BofA Merrill Lynch Emerging Markets Corporate Bond ETF (EMCD) and the SPDR BofA Merrill Lynch Crossover Corporate Bond ETF (XOVR). The two new SPDR ETFs, which have been listed on the NYSE Arca, provide investors with an opportunity to access the attractive yield and total return potential of emerging market corporate debt and crossover corporate bonds.

Huntington Asset Advisors, a subsidiary of Ohio-based Huntington National Bank, has made its debut in the US ETF space with the launch, on the NYSE Arca, of the Huntington EcoLogical Strategy ETF (HECO). HECO, the first of two initial planned ETFs under the company’s newly minted ‘Huntington Strategy Shares’ brand, is an actively managed ETF that focuses on sustainable and environmentally-friendly companies.
